GENERAL PROBLEMS ON MINOR STOPPAGES Efforts to actualize as losses are not sufficient.
Actions taken are poor .-Only emergency measures are taken as temporary measures.
Phenomena are not discerned fully.
Obstruction to unattendance operation. -Operators are used for restoration.-Minor stoppages keep operators from operating multiple stations or machines.-One minor stoppage will ruin the effects of unattendance operation during breaks. JIPM, 1994

Pneumatic circuit modified with a push button ,so that,whenever the push button is pressed air will be supplied to the gauge and no air supply whenever the push button is realeased.
COST SAVING/GAUGE Rs = 17.20 /DAY FOR 55 GAUGES =950/DAY . SAVING /ANNUM = Rs2.85Lakhs .
Arrest air wastage when gaugwe is not in use.
Air wastage through the one mm hole in the air gauges when not in use
No. control valve for the air circuit
Wastage of compressed air through air gauges when not in use.
Air wastage is eliminated by closing the circuit(push button) after usage.
